WebMar 12, 2024 · The EYLF describes cultural competence as, “much more than an awareness of cultural differences. It is the ability to understand, communicate with, and effectively interact with people across cultures”. …

Young children experience their world through a densely woven fabric of relationships, and these relationships affect virtually all aspects of their development. Secure attachment is especially important in the first months of a child’s life. The EYLF is structured around recognition of childhood being a time of belonging, being and becoming. In recognition of this the EYLF is structured for outcomes that will aid and support these concepts.
